After the injection, many doctors will examine your eye with a light and clean around your eye. Most will ask you to use antibiotic eye drops for a day or two. Your eye will probably be sore and your vision somewhat foggy for a day or two, and then should improve. Any discomfort can often be relieved with ...Some medications can be injected in more than one way. EpiPens (epinephrine) used to treat severe allergic reactions can be given via IM or SC injection, for example. One study (N = 164) surveyed nurses on the occurrence of aspirating for blood return during an IM injection (Thomas et al., 2016). The reported frequency of aspiration was 48% (79/164) aspirated every time, while 26% (42/164) aspirated about 90% of the time.
